Field Hockey Falls In Overtime to Cortland, 2-1

GENESEO, N.Y. - The SUNY Geneseo Field Hockey team battled back from another one-goal halftime deficit, but fell just short dropping an overtime loss to Cortland, 2-1, in the State University of New York Athletic Conference (SUNYAC) Championship game on Saturday afternoon at College Stadium.

HOW IT HAPPENED 
  • The Red Dragons outshot the Knights, 2-1, in the first quarter as both teams battled for posession of the ball. Cortland finally took the lead in the second quarter, converting off of a penalty corner to make it 1-0. 
  • The Knights posessed the ball for most the second quarter but could not find the equalizer and went into the half trailing by a goal. First-year defender Hailey Roethel made a crucial defensive save just before halftime, parrying the ball away off the goal line to keep it at 1-0.
  • In the third quarter, Geneseo pressured throughout the frame and earned a penalty stroke midway through the frame. Senior forward Maggie Phipps stepped up to the spot but her shot was knocked away by the Cortland goalkeeper. 
  • The Knights finally drew level in the fourth quarter when Darby Matthews netted her second goal of the SUNYAC Tournament off of a penalty corner, making it 1-1 with under 8:00 to play. 
  • Geneseo had several opportunities to drive home the game winning goal in the fourth quarter and overtime, but could not convert. Cortland scored on a counter-attack with 1:18 remaining as a rebound bounced off the post and in front of the cage for Cortland to put away to seal the victory. 

QUICK FACTS 
  • The Knights finish their season with a 15-4 record, reaching 15 victories for just the third time in program history. 
  • Darby Matthews, Ada Roe and Hailey Roethel were each named to the SUNYAC All-Tournament Team. 
  • Geneseo outshot Cortland 8-4 in the fourth quarter and overtime period combined and had not allowed a shot in the overtime period until the goal-scoring sequence with 1:20 remaining.
